Automation Error Vb6 Excel
Contents |
resources Windows Server 2012 resources Programs MSDN subscriptions Overview Benefits Administrators Students Microsoft Imagine Microsoft Student Partners ISV Startups TechRewards Events Community Magazine Forums Blogs Channel 9 Documentation APIs and reference Dev centers Retired content Samples We’re sorry. The content you vb6 automation error accessing the ole registry requested has been removed. You’ll be auto redirected in 1 second. Reference Trappable Errors Core
Vb6 Automation Error The Object Invoked Has Disconnected From Its Clients
Visual Basic Language Errors Core Visual Basic Language Errors 440 Automation error 440 Automation error 440 Automation error 3 Return without
Vb6 Automation Error Classfactory Cannot Supply Requested Class
GoSub 5 Invalid procedure call or argument 6 Overflow 7 Out of memory 9 Subscript out of range 10 This array is fixed or temporarily locked 11 Division by zero 13 Type mismatch 14 Out of
Vb6 Automation Error The System Cannot Find The File Specified
string space 16 Expression too complex 17 Can't perform requested operation 18 User interrupt occurred 20 Resume without error 28 Out of stack space 35 Sub, Function, or Property not defined 47 Too many DLL application clients 48 Error in loading DLL 49 Bad DLL calling convention 51 Internal error 52 Bad file name or number 53 Can't find specified file 54 Bad file mode 55 File already open 57 Device I\O error automation error in vb6 on windows 7 58 File already exists 59 Bad record length 61 Disk full 62 Input past end of file 63 Bad record number 67 Too many files 68 Device unavailable 70 Permission denied 71 Disk not ready 74 Can't rename with different drive 75 Path\File access error 76 Path not found 91 Object variable or With block variable not set 92 For loop not initialized 93 Invalid pattern string 94 Invalid use of Null 96 Can't sink this object's events because it's already firing events... 97 Can't call Friend procedure on an object that isn't an instance of... 98 A property or method call cannot include a reference to a private ... 321 Invalid file format 322 Can't create necessary temporary file 400 Form already displayed; can't show modally 422 Property not found 429 ActiveX component can't create object or return reference to this... 430 Class doesn't support Automation 432 File name or class name not found during Automation operation 438 Object doesn't support this property or method 440 Automation error 442 Connection to type library or object library for remote process h... 443 Automation object doesn't have a default value 445 Object doesn't support this action 446 Object doesn't support named arguments 447 Object doesn't support current locale setting 448 Named argument not found 449 Argu
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about Stack Overflow the company Business Learn runtime error 440 automation error vb6 more about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users automation error library not registered vb6 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ping automation error element not found vb6 each other. Join them; it only takes a minute: Sign up What is causing “Automation error Unspecified error” on Worksheet_Activate? up vote 2 down vote favorite 2 I have a worksheet named "Dates" (object name is A_Dates) that https://msdn.microsoft.com/en-us/library/aa264508(v=vs.60).aspx needs to be calculated when it is activated (It may be worth noting that this is in my Personal macro workbook). I regularly have workbooks open that have too many calculations in the for me to have auto-calculation on. So I have auto-calc set to manual, and the following code in the worksheet: Private Sub Worksheet_Activate() A_Dates.Calculate End Sub This has worked fine for the last 3 months, day-in and day-out. Yesterday, it stopped working. It http://stackoverflow.com/questions/12270922/what-is-causing-automation-error-unspecified-error-on-worksheet-activate now throws this error on the declaration line: Microsoft Visual Basic Automation error Unspecified error [OK] [Help] I have tried changing how I reference the sheet, using: Sheets("Dates").Calculate and ActiveSheet.Calculate to no avail. I've also included error handling: On Error Resume Next which doesn't prevent it. I've even gone so far as: Private Sub Worksheet_Activate() On Error GoTo headache Sheets("Dates").Calculate Exit Sub headache: Exit Sub End Sub and it still shows up. I am totally at a loss. Help? Additional Information I have the following references, and use all of them in various macros in this workbook: Visual Basic for Applications Microsoft Excel 12.0 Object Library OLE Automation Microsoft Office 12.0 Object Library Microsoft Scripting Runtime Microsoft Forms 2.0 Object Runtime Microsoft HTML Object Library Microsoft Internet Controls Microsoft ActiveX Data Objects 2.8 Library Microsoft ActiveX Data Objects Recordset 2.8 Library vba error-handling excel-2007 share|improve this question edited Sep 4 '12 at 21:43 asked Sep 4 '12 at 20:30 Farfromunique 1291112 If you comment that line out and manually force a Recalc (using [F9]) do you receive an error? –mwolfe02 Sep 4 '12 at 21:13 No, I do not. And, everything seems to calculate correctly. –Farfromunique Sep 4 '12 at 21:14 Maybe the error has to do with running any VBA, not necessarily the Calculate method. What if you try replacing A_Da
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n http://stackoverflow.com/questions/25029484/vb6-program-fails-opening-excel-2007-with-automation-error-library-not-registere more about Stack Overflow the company Business Learn more about hiring developers or posting http://www.vbforums.com/showthread.php?568467-RESOLVED-Excel-automation-error ads with us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up VB6 program fails opening Excel 2007 with Automation Error Library automation error not registered up vote 1 down vote favorite I created this VB6 program on my Windows 7 32bit machine with Office 2010 32bit, which runs fine. Tested it on a Windows 8 64 bit machine with Office 2013 32bit, it works. On one machine with, Windows 7 64 bit and Office 2007(32 bit only) it throws an error during the following piece of code. The actual error message: vb6 automation error Run-time Error –2147319779 (8002801d) Automation error, Library not registered VB6 Code: If (excel_app Is Nothing) Then Set excel_app = CreateObject("Excel.Application") Else Set excel_app = GetObject(, "Excel.Application") End If excel_app.Visible = True excel_version = excel_app.Application.Version Set wBook = excel_app.Workbooks.Open(directory_path & "\templates\book1.xlsm") So it is throwing the error when I open book1. It actual does open it and it has a macro run on Workbook_Open(), this runs right through seemly fine. After it finishes and processing of the program returns to the VB6 program it throws the error. Here are the project references: Has anyone come across this and what would be the fix? [EDIT] I am obviously doing something wrong here my error handler is throwing an error. I did try one other thing and that was removed "Set wBook = " and it didn't throw an error. I have placed "Set wBook = " back since then, as I do need it further on in my code. Dim wBook As Workbook Dim excel_app As Object On Error GoTo trialhandler If (excel_app Is Nothing) Then Set excel_app = CreateObject("Excel.Application") Else Set excel_app = GetObject(, "Excel.Application") End If excel_app.Visible = True excel_version = excel_app.Application.Version Set wBook = excel_app.Workbooks.Open(directory_path & "\templates\book1.xlsm") MsgBox ("Exiting") Exit Sub tri
this is your first vis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below. Results 1 to 4 of 4 Thread: [RESOLVED] Excel automation error Tweet Thread Tools Show Printable Version Subscribe to this Thread… Display Linear Mode Switch to Hybrid Mode Switch to Threaded Mode May 7th, 2009,07:14 PM #1 projecttoday View Profile View Forum Posts Thread Starter Fanatic Member Join Date May 2004 Location South Charleston, WV, USA Posts 550 [RESOLVED] Excel automation error I am modifying an Excel spreadsheet with VBA code in Access and I get the error "Unable to set the orientation property of the pagesetup class" on the following statement: xls.pagesetup.Orientation = xllandscape Since this statement: xls.pagesetup.LeftMargin = 0 works, that doesn't make sense to me. Anybody have any ideas? I'm trying to modify a spreadsheet so it will print properly on legal-sized paper. This is the complete code I'm using, The error occurs on the last line. Everything up to that point works. Dim xlx As Object, xlw As Object, xls As Object, xlc As Object Dim blnEXCEL As Boolean blnEXCEL = False ' Establish an EXCEL application object On Error Resume Next Set xlx = GetObject(, "Excel.Application") If Err.Number <> 0 Then Set xlx = CreateObject("Excel.Application") blnEXCEL = True End If Err.Clear On Error GoTo 0 xlx.Visible = True Set xlw = xlx.workbooks.Open("C:\Documents and Settings\Call Agent\My Documents\schedulereport.xls", , False) ' Replace WorksheetName with the actual name of the worksheet ' in the EXCEL file Set xls = xlw.worksheets("qryPropexcelwithdates") xls.columns("A:O").RowHeight = 26 xls.range("B1:O1").Font.Bold = True xls.pagesetup.LeftMargin = 0 xls.pagesetup.RightMargin = 0 xls.pagesetup.Orientation = xllandscape Reply With Quote May 8th, 2009,04:24 AM #2 Siddharth Rout View Profile View Forum Posts Visit Homepage Super Moderator Join Date Feb 2005 Location Mumbai, India Posts 11,940 Re: Excel automation error Ok I tested your code with a sample file and every thing worked just fine with no errors... I just renamed the objects for a better understanding... vb Code: Sub Test() Dim oXLApp As Object, oXLWb As Object,